The genesis of Project Hockey traces back to the founder’s experiences growing up in a non-traditional hockey market, specifically Arizona. Lacking guidance on off-ice training outside the rink, the founder received encouragement from coaches to engage in extra training and stick-handling at home, yet the “how” and “why” were often overlooked. Project Hockey is a response to this gap, aiming to provide athletes with the essential “how” and “why” of at-home training for continuous hockey player development. As the founder transitioned from playing to coaching, Project Hockey evolved into a passionate endeavor, committed to reaching hockey players at every level and facilitating their growth through extra effort and dedication.
